Position Summary:

Lead teams in a dynamic operational environment, to consistently exceed established goals, demonstrate a commitment to customers and a dedication to excellence and innovation. Develop forward looking plans and turn those plans into successful execution. Effectively manage resources to achieve operational excellence and meet or exceed the site financial operating plan. Implement and maintain an incident free safety culture at the operation.

Major Responsibilities:

People
• Establish and sustain that all supervisors and associates are trained and competent and understand how their work relates to the customers' business objectives
• Establish and sustain that we recruit, hire, train, develop and retain quality associates.
• Establish and sustain effective, two-way communication that informs and motivates as well as recognizes excellence among team members
• Establish and sustain strong and effective relationships with associates, the customer, and supporting departments

Operations
• Meet or exceed all customer key performance metrics and objectives
• Interact daily with local customer to ensure existing and emerging customer needs are understood
• Lead team to identify operational improvements in areas such as route optimization, carrier selection, backhauls, and trailer loading
• Collaborate with other Penske sites to share best practices, leverage resources/assets, etc.

Finance
• Develop and execute annual financial and operating plan
• Lead the operation with integrity to meet or exceed the Business Plan targets
• Identify issues with the operating metrics and P&L and make required adjustments in a timely manner
• Ensure customer billings and associate payroll are prepared timely and accurately, the payables and intercompany charges are valid and correct, and all other activities are accurately reflected in the P&L.

Safety
• Lead a culture of safety through personal example
• Develop, execute, and assess continuous improvement plan to reduce accident and injury frequency
• Ensure each associate understands their individual role and responsibilities, as well as the group's role and responsibilities required to achieve and maintain a safe work place
• Proactively identify and correct unsafe conditions, work processes, and behaviors
• Ensure compliance with all applicable regulatory agencies, company policies and procedures
• Coach through safety observations

Growth/Customer Experience
• Identify opportunities for continuous improvement and challenge the status quo
• Execute a process to track and record value delivered to the customer
• Identify and seize profitable business opportunities for the customer and Penske
• Utilize available metrics to monitor and maximize customer efficiencies and achieve cost savings.

Fleet/Assets
• Lead effort to improve fleet/equipment utilization, maintenance availability and fuel efficiency
• Contribute to equipment specification at time of start-up and renewal
• Build a strong working relationship with local PTL district and other equipment vendors
• Other projects and tasks as assigned by supervisor

About Penske Logistics

Penske Logistics is a wholly owned subsidiary of Penske Truck Leasing that provides logistics services to manufacturers, retailers and distributors. The company operates in North America, South America, Europe and Asia. Penske Logistics has more than 50,000 employees and manages a fleet of more than 300,000 vehicles. The company offers a range of services, including transportation management, warehousing and distribution, lead logistics, cross-docking, and supply chain consulting. Penske Logistics has been recognized for its sustainability efforts, including being named to the EPA's SmartWay Excellence Award list.
